Mitchell College vs. Herzing University-Kenosha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Mitchell College or Herzing University-Kenosha?

  • Mitchell College is 196.2% more expensive to attend than Herzing University-Kenosha for in-state tuition ($35,006.00 vs. $11,820.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 196.2% higher at Mitchell College than Herzing University Kenosha ($35,006.00 vs. $11,820.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Herzing University Kenosha than Mitchell College ($21,126 vs. $30,365)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Herzing University Kenosha are 60.1% lower than costs at Mitchell College ($9,243 vs. $14,800)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Mitchell College than Herzing University Kenosha (100% vs. 83%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Mitchell College students is 258.4% larger than aid received Herzing University Kenosha ($21,641 vs. $6,039)

Mitchell College vs. Herzing University-Kenosha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Mitchell College or Herzing University-Kenosha?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Herzing University-Kenosha and Mitchell College.

  • Graduates from Herzing University Kenosha earn on average $10,500 more per year than Mitchell College graduates after ten years. ($43,400 vs. $32,900)
  • Herzing University Kenosha students graduate with a $2,037 lower median federal student loan debt than Mitchell College graduates. ($23,713 vs. $25,750)
  • Herzing University-Kenosha graduates are paying $21 less per month on federal student loans than Mitchell College graduates. ($245 vs. $266)
  • More Mitchell College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Herzing University-Kenosha students, three years after graduation. (62% vs. 28%)
